Job Description

·         Participate in the development of the patient/family plan of care.

·         Make home visits to evaluate patients presenting problems and perform appropriate examination utilizing specialized evaluation expertise.

·         Develop a specialized care plan based on the evaluation and on the goals recommended by the interdisciplinary team and agreed to by the patient and attending physician.

·         Implement the treatment program through direct treatment of the patient.

·         Reassess clinical signs and symptoms to determine effectiveness of program.

·         Advise and instruct patient, family and Advantage Home Care staff regarding participation in the treatment program.

·         Observe and report the Director or the Nurse Case Manager the patient’s reaction to the physical therapy regimen and any related changes in the patient’s condition.

·         Participate in the Interdisciplinary Team conference, as necessary.

·         Supervise assistants, providing continuous and in close proximity supervision to the assistant performing the related tasks. Must be readily available, at all times, to provide advice or instruction to the assistant.

·         Directing or supervising physical therapist shall notify the Board in writing of the commencement of the relationship and shall assume full responsibility for the professional activities of the assistant.

·         The directing or supervising physical therapist shall provide the Board with written notification of the termination of this relationship.

·         The physical therapist shall not be responsible for the direction or supervision of more than 2 assistants.

·         The direction and supervision of the physical therapy assistant(s) shall be the following:

·         The referring physical therapist is responsible for the patient’s care.

·         The supervising physical therapist shall be on call and readily available within a 100 mile radius or appoint another physical therapist in his/her absence.

·         A current written plan of care shall be formulated for each patient by the referring physical therapist and shall be revised following periodic re-evaluations.

·         It is the sole responsibility of the directing or supervising physical therapist to ensure safety of the patient and the quality of care rendered.

·         Document care and services provided on agency’s record and consultation forms within the time frame consistent with the agency’s policy.
